About G. Suresh

G. Suresh is a scholar working on Fluid Flow and Transfer Processes, Automotive Engineering and Bioengineering, having authored 31 papers that have together received 1.0k indexed citations. Recurring topics across this work include Advanced Battery Materials and Technologies (16 papers), Advancements in Battery Materials (16 papers) and Advanced Battery Technologies Research (9 papers). The work is most often cited by research in Electrical and Electronic Engineering (795 citations), Automotive Engineering (154 citations) and Fluid Flow and Transfer Processes (78 citations). G. Suresh has collaborated with scholars based in India, Saudi Arabia and Malaysia. Frequent co-authors include T. V. Venkatesha, Michela Brunelli, A. Mitelman, Doron Aurbach, Elena Levi, Orit Chusid, H. Manjunatha, Ashok K. Pandey, A. Goswami and S. Sodaye. Their work appears in journals such as Advanced Materials, The Journal of Physical Chemistry B and Journal of The Electrochemical Society.
